Laura Mvula bounces back from being controversially and unceremoniously dropped by her previous record label with the vibrant, 80s-inflected 'Pink Noise' (CD, Pink LP and indies Orange LP). Channelling the synth-funk of Prince and the yachty production of 'Thriller'-era MJ while maintaining the impressively layered chamber-like vocal arrangements which Mvula brought to her previous work, 'Pink Noise' is a defiant statement of liberation from an ever evolving artist.

'Forest Of Your Problems' is a third full-length from woodwose post-punks and ghillie suit enthusiasts Snapped Ankles, available on CD and indies "protestor edition" on "forest floor" eco mix vinyl. Their Teutonic forest rhythms take on a more reflective hue this time around but their drily delivered barbed takes on the Capitalocene retain their edge.

A couple of Impulse! essentials are reissued on the audiophile Verve Acoustic Sounds series: Sonny Rollins' label debut and Oliver Nelson's 'The Blues And The Abstract Truth' which celebrates its 50th anniversary this year and features the heavyweight frontline of Eric Dolphy and Freddie Hubbard alongside Bill Evans, Paul Chambers and Roy Haynes.
